5. I’m interested in incorporating telework into my company’s business practices, but I fear my workers will waste time or spend time on non-job-related tasks. How can I be sure my teleworkers are productive?

Studies have revealed that telework actually maintains and in some cases increases productivity. No commute. No office chit chat. No office donut delivery. No jokes of the day from the office clown. When you telework, you deal with less disruptions and can maximize the time you spend working. No lengthy commute means workers have more time to work and far less headaches.

There will always be workers who do not do their jobs, but this is the case in and out of the traditional office environment. Managers can put in place an accountability system to help teleworkers stay on task and reach business goals.
